Tottenham Hotspur’s new £65million summer signing, Dominic Solanke, will miss the team’s upcoming match against Everton on Saturday due to an ankle injury, according to manager Ange Postecoglou.

The 26-year-old striker, who joined the club from Bournemouth last week, suffered the injury during Spurs’ 1-1 draw against Leicester City on Monday night. Postecoglou confirmed on Friday that Solanke would miss the match against the Toffees, stating that the injury had “flared up” since the game.

During his debut, Solanke had appeared slightly off pace with the rest of his teammates, failing to convert several chances for Spurs in the first half. Postecoglou added that the injury was not serious and that Solanke would likely return after the international break.

Richarlison, who has been out since May with a calf injury, is set to replace Solanke in the starting lineup. Postecoglou stated that the winger was “ready to go” and would likely start against Everton.

Rodrigo Bentancur will also miss the match due to a head injury sustained during Monday’s game. Postecoglou confirmed that the midfielder would be out for the time being, citing the need to respect concussion protocols.

Yves Bissouma, who was suspended for the opening Premier League fixture due to a video showing him inhaling laughing gas, may return to the matchday squad against Everton. Postecoglou stated that Bissouma was available for selection, adding that the pair had begun repairing their relationship.
